FH and I are having a little tiff with his parents about our list.  Shower invites have already gone out and wedding invitations have been ordered and to be sent out in a week. We have had this conversation 3 times now but it doesnt seem to be setting in with them

The lady at the hall said she can fit 250 people (including WP) by using only round tables, which is what I want.  So our list right now is 280. Which to me is perfect cuz that allows 30 people to reply no. Yet his parents are saying invite 300 to get 200 yeses.

FH's cousin just got married last year and they only had 17 no's, so being that it is pretty much the same family this is what I am using as a reference. So can you guys tell me how many no's/no shows you guys had at your weddings?
